To become a Chicago police officer, applicants must have one of the following: 60 semester hours of college credit; three years of continuous active duty with the United States Armed Forces; or one year of continuous active duty with the United States Armed Forces combined with 30 semester hours of college credit. Probationary Chicago police officers start at a salary around $47,000, depending on education and experience.2This is increased to $72,510 after 18 months of service.2All officers receive competitive health and life insurance benefits as well as paid time off for vacations and holidays. Although the 60 semester hours of college credit that are required to qualify for the CPD can be in any subject, earning an associate's or bachelor's degree in criminal justice or a related field can increase an applicant's chances of being hired as well as provide additional opportunities for career advancement. Candidates who are at least 18 years of age may take the exam to qualify for the hiring process and be placed on the CPD eligibility list, but cannot be hired until they reach the age of 21. One of the immediate goals is to provide a pool of qualified applicants for the citys police and fire academies. After completion of the two years in high school and two years at a city college, students will have met the minimum educational requirements to take the Chicago Police and Fire Department examinations for entry into their respective academies.
